Becoming
One thing I hope this Happier Habits Programme has shown you is that you are a glorious work in progress. That life is in perpetual motion and what is true today, may not be the same tomorrow.
By building a dynamic, relationship with yourself you are harnessing all of your life experiences and learnings, investing in a happier today and all your future selves. You are never done becoming. And self-investment is not about money necessarily, but about investing in that becoming, daily.
It means not striving to be get somewhere, or waiting for the time when you're thinner, divorced, met someone, got your shit together. It means investing energy, thought, time, curiosity, attention, intention, every day on who you are, how you are, where you are, where you are heading, and what you need and want. It's getting off default mode at least some of the time, and embracing your life with agency and attitude. It's committing and investing the time to check in every day, be proactive in how you want to feel, consciously ensuring the things that bring back your mood, or make you feel more alive or connected to yourself happen, being intentional about your actions, and reflecting on your progress, your reactions and responses. It's about remembering that you are not in fact, a human doing, but a human being.

Miracle Question
In the PlaySheet, establish where you are right now and then answer the 'miracle question.' If you could wake up in 6 months, or a year, (or even three years) and a miracle has happened and you were feeling the way you wanted to feel, and living the life you want to be living (given the actual context of your life so you can't be winning the lottery!) what would be happening, what would changed? How would you feel? This could be a series of things eg I will have come to terms with something, I will have better knowledge about something, I feel better supported, etc. This in itself gives you a springboard for small actions eg therapy, research, new doctor, negotiated better supports at work etc
Your Midlife Mantra
In the PlaySheet, write out a Midlife Mantra that will keep you motivated, focussed on the direction you want, and create an anchor for the future. Because life will come with lots of white noise and lots of curveballs (and lots of opportunities) and this will be your North Star.
This can be a statement, a paragraph, a warrior cry, a letter to yourself, an essay or a few words.
It is your promise and guidance to yourself, to be your best champion, to steer you with intention and investment in yourself to the place you want to go and the way you want your life to feel. It is your GPS, your guiding light, your vision and mission. It can’t just be a destination, but a proactive empowering motivation for when the shit hits the fan and when the sun shines, so always mattering more in your own midlife.
